DESCRIPTION

“Tezumi” means hand-picked. This sencha is grown in Utogi village, hight up Tatsuyama mountain in Shizuoka. It is lightly steamed, which is called “Asamushi” method. Both Tezumi and Asamushi methods contribute to the taste and beauty of the tea. The dried leaves are glossy deep green. The tea cultivar is Yabukita which is common for Sencha. Sencha is a popular everyday tea in the Japanese homes.
